Course Details

Introduction to Competition Impact Assessment: Understanding the concept, importance, and process of competition impact assessment.

Regulatory Framework: Exploring national and international laws, regulations, and policies related to competition assessment.

Market Analysis: Studying market structures, dynamics, and player behavior to identify potential competition issues.

Economic Principles: Applying microeconomic theories to understand market competition and its effects.

Competition Assessment Tools: Mastering techniques and methodologies for evaluating the competitive impact of business decisions, mergers, and acquisitions.

Risk Management: Ident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ks associated with competition assessments.

Stakeholder Engagement: Effectively engaging with various stakeholders, including regulators, competitors, and customers, during the assessment process.

Case Studies: Analyzing real-world examples of competition impact assessments to reinforce learning and develop critical thinking skills.

Effective Communication: Developing persuasive communication strategies for presenting assessment results and recommendations to decision-makers.
